Sohail Adnan clinches British Junior Open Squash Championship

ISLAMABAD: Pakistani youth Sohail Adnan created history by winning the gold medal in the British Junior Open Squash Championship.

According to the details, Adnan won the title in the Under-13 category, Pakistan’s first victory in this championship in 18 years.

In the final, Adnan defeated Egypt’s Moeez Tamer Al-Maghazi in a thrilling match to win 3-2.

This victory came soon after Adnan won the title in the Scottish Junior Open Squash Championship.

Punjab Squash Association President Noorul Amin Mengal congratulated Adnan on his historic achievement.
